Mentoring and New Student Orientation Mentoring is an important program that unites 1L’s with upperclassmen and the administration. Each spring, students are selected by the SBA to serve as mentors for the incoming 1L class. The mentors work together to plan events, offer advice, and guide new students during the notorious first-year of law school. The mentoring program in integral to the administration of SBA because it provides an opportunity for students of all classes and sections to communicate with each other and SBA about concerns, complaints, issues, and ideas.
